The Netherlands functional composites market is experiencing steady growth driven by the demand from various industries such as automotive, aerospace, construction, and electronics. Functional composites offer lightweight properties, high strength, and corrosion resistance, making them an attractive choice for manufacturers looking to improve product performance. The market is witnessing increasing investments in research and development activities to innovate new composite materials with enhanced functionalities. Key players in the Netherlands functional composites market are focusing on strategic partnerships, mergers, and acquisitions to expand their product offerings and strengthen their market presence. Sustainability and environmental concerns are also driving the adoption of eco-friendly composites in the market. Overall, the Netherlands functional composites market is poised for continued growth in the coming years.

In the Netherlands functional composites market, challenges such as high production costs, limited availability of raw materials, and competition from other materials like traditional metals and plastics are prominent. The need for specialized equipment and skilled labor adds to the production costs, making it difficult for companies to offer competitive pricing. Additionally, the reliance on imported raw materials can lead to supply chain disruptions and price fluctuations. Moreover, the market faces the challenge of educating potential customers about the benefits of functional composites over traditional materials, as well as ensuring regulatory compliance and meeting quality standards. Overall, addressing these challenges will be crucial for the growth and sustainability of the functional composites market in the Netherlands.

In the Netherlands, government policies related to the functional composites market focus on promoting sustainability and innovation within the industry. The Dutch government has implemented initiatives to support the use of composites in various sectors, such as construction, automotive, and aerospace, by providing funding for research and development projects, promoting collaboration between industry stakeholders, and encouraging the adoption of eco-friendly materials. Additionally, regulations and standards are in place to ensure the safety and quality of composites used in different applications. The government also emphasizes the importance of circular economy principles, aiming to reduce waste and promote recycling in the composites sector. Overall, the Netherlands government`s policies aim to drive growth and competitiveness in the functional composites market while advancing sustainability goals.
